Brush down the walls to remove any dust, dirt and cobwebs. If the walls have been painted previously, remove any flaking paint with a pressure washer or wire brush. Use exterior filler to repair any cracks, and move any climbing plants and trellises out of the way as much as possible.

While most houses in the Dublin are constructed with a tooth cavity, older residences need to be kept and painted by a tradesperson that recognizes the significance of breathability. Bonus treatment ought to be taken when servicing solid walls and/or any wall made with breathable products such as lime mortar. For non-listed structures, you should not require permission as routine painting is thought about upkeep.

When picking a topcoat, check out its compatibility with undercoats and also primers. Problem can develop when painting over an existing paint and you ought to review the instructions on your paint tin or get professional advice from your provider prior to starting the work.
There will certainly be no need to sand the surface area nonetheless if there is the possibility of any wax existing this should be eliminated. White spirit and cord woollen is a reliable approach for getting rid of wax. Make sure all jobs are accomplished in a well aerated location, as soon as the surface area has actually been topped with Zinsser B-I-N you can apply an oil based leading layer. Always prime your walls before painting if the surface is porous. The surface is porous when it absorbs water, moisture, oil, odors or stains. This material will literally absorb your paint right into it if you don't prime first. Untreated or unstained wood is also very porous.

The very first coat requires time to dry before the painter can use a second coat. The drying time will certainly rely on what sort of paint has been used, as well as just how well aerated the room is. Under optimal problems, latex paint ought to be ready for a 2nd coat after 4 hours.
